Molybdenum ASTM B387

TABLE1 Chemical Requirements
Element Composition,%
Material Number
360 361 363 364 365 366
C 0.030max 0.010max 0.010-0.030 0.010-0.040 0.010max 0.030max
O,MAXA 0.0015 0.0070 0.0030 0.030 0.0015 0.0025
N,MAXA 0.002 0.002 0.002 0.002 0.002 0.002
Fe,MAX 0.010 0.010 0.010 0.010 0.010 0.010
Ni,MAX 0.002 0.005 0.002 0.005 0.002 0.002
Si,MAX 0.010 0.010 0.010 0.005 0.010 0.010
Ti ... ... 0.40-0.55 0.40-0.55 ... ...
W ... ... ... ... ... 27-33
Zr ... ... 0.06-0.12 0.06-0.12 ... ...
Mo balance balance balance balance balance balance

A Pending approved methods of analysis,deviations these limits alone sahll not be cause for rejection.
